Output 89d50240e0e1e6d8baf14dcde639604fb02d1979429b95375f714c0a986b98c1:5

value
812708
script pubkey
OP_0 OP_PUSHBYTES_20 867fbde04d41b30eec2cd03f84efbc5522a730c2
address
bc1qselmmczdgxesampv6qlcfmau2532wvxz668lhc
transaction
89d50240e0e1e6d8baf14dcde639604fb02d1979429b95375f714c0a986b98c1
confirmations
170199
spent
true